WS-Discovery

来自运维百科
板板讨论 | 贡献2024年2月1日 (四) 12:43的版本 (创建页面,内容为“WS-Discovery(Web Services Discovery)是一种基于网络服务的自动发现协议。它被用于在局域网中自动发现和定位网络设备和服务。 WS-Discovery是由联合技术研究院(OASIS)开发和标准化的,使用SOAP(Simple Object Access Protocol)和UDP(User Datagram Protocol)等网络协议进行通信。 WS-Discovery的工作原理如下: 消息发布:网络设备和服务在局域网上发送WS-Discovery消息…”)
(差异) ←上一版本 | 最后版本 (差异) | 下一版本→ (差异)

WS-Discovery(Web Services Discovery)是一种基于网络服务的自动发现协议。它被用于在局域网中自动发现和定位网络设备和服务。

WS-Discovery是由联合技术研究院(OASIS)开发和标准化的,使用SOAP(Simple Object Access Protocol)和UDP(User Datagram Protocol)等网络协议进行通信。

WS-Discovery的工作原理如下:

消息发布:网络设备和服务在局域网上发送WS-Discovery消息来宣布它们的存在和提供的服务。这些消息可以包括设备的类型、地址、服务描述等信息。 消息订阅:其他设备可以发送WS-Discovery消息来订阅特定类型的设备或服务。订阅设备将接收到所订阅类型的设备或服务的通知。 消息解析和回应:当设备收到WS-Discovery消息时,它将解析消息并根据需要作出响应。响应可以是设备或服务的详细信息,也可以是进一步协商连接或进行交互的指令。 WS-Discovery具有以下优点和功能:

零配置:WS-Discovery支持零配置网络,在网络设备中无需手动配置IP地址或其他参数,即可自动发现和建立连接。 动态发现:WS-Discovery允许动态添加或移除设备和服务,并实时通知其他设备和服务。 灵活性:WS-Discovery支持多种设备类型和服务,可以根据不同的需求进行订阅和定位。 跨平台:WS-Discovery是一种跨平台和跨厂商的协议,可以在不同操作系统和设备之间进行交互。 由于其易用性、自动化和跨平台特性,WS-Discovery被广泛应用于各种场景,如智能家居、物联网、视频监控等。它提供了一种方便和高效的方式来发现和连接网络中的设备和服务,实现灵活的互联和交互。